Step-Up (Boost) Regulators, Internal Power Switch Boost, Linear Technology


Linear Technology presents step-up (boost) switching regulators with both synchronous and non-synchronous internal switches. The high efficient DC-DC converters have a wide range of input voltages and switching frequencies. Some products feature unique properties that can help increase battery run time in handheld devices or even be managed in a range of switching configurations. Typical applications would be power inverters, fully floating multiple outputs and 5V logic supplies.

Switching Voltage Regulators, Linear Technology


Linear Technology product series of synchronous and non-synchronous internal switching regulator ICs offer high efficiency plus a wide input voltage range and switching frequencies up to 4MHz.
The controllers span over several types of configurations from buck (step-down), boost (step-up), buck-boost, forward, Isolated, Inverting and flyback controllers. The Flyback, Forward and Isolated Controllers primary and secondary side provide a solution to help replace the DC/DC bricks that get used in back-plane power conversion.
